A couple of years after the lucky day in which I survived an accident in the middle of Africa, I was introduced to this amazing organisation, Changing Faces. James Partridge, the founder and a super impressive man who had incurred severe burns to his face, established the charity with the intention of demystifying facial disfigurement by creating greater awareness and so greater acceptance of different looking faces.
Along with running courses and workshops to equip people like me with the skills with which to face the world, Changing Faces has also branched out into schools and hospitals, giving mind broadening talks to educate people. They particularly focus on children and teenagers who have a far harder time dealing with disfigurement than us older individuals.
25 years on the charity has made enormous inroads to help many affected, to give them greater confidence and life skills whilst also gently challenging prejudices of others.
